2019 Bloggers On Top Unconference in Bulgaria: Highlights + Live Stream

For the third year in a row, Bloggers On Top unconference brought together 30 content creators and tourism professionals in Bansko, Bulgaria,  to learn more about the ins and outs of professional blogging.

What is Bloggers On Top and who attended?

Bloggers on Top 2019 took place in Bansko – once a renowned winter sports resort, and now the up-and-coming international digital nomad hub in Bulgaria. The event was again organized and hosted by Coworking Bansko.

The concept behind the 3-day unconference is to gather in one place a small group of people to share their knowledge, ideas and feedback on everything related to blogging in the tourism industry.

This year, around 30 local and international travel insiders participated, including professionals from Australia, the US, The Netherlands, Latvia, and more.

Many active Travel Massive members joined the event, such as Edgar Pless, Martin Totev, Mark Philips, Peter Syme, and Ian Cumming, founder of Travel Massive, at Bloggers On Top this year.

What topics were discussed?

During the unconference sessions, we discussed many relevant topics including SEO for bloggers and businesses, how to monetize your blog, how to grow your affiliate marketing income, ways to promote travel destinations, and how to rock in social media. Everyone was encouraged to contribute with the knowledge they had.

Among the discussions that stood out were the “Tools and Resources for bloggers and businesses” led by Alex van den Elsen, founder of Marketing Menu (to be launched at end of the month); “Ins and Outs of Influencer Marketing” by Maria Nedelcheva, digital marketing specialist and blogger at Adventures of a Bulgarian Mermaid, and many more.

Participants also learned about the power of video, storytelling, photography, how to speak the language of WordPress, including some serious tech tricks by Ian.
